Output 35c20b84b85e09771a76160c081d3e9b9f184680157e4137de5cc03db1b715e7:2

value
4373942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16e5510624ca14de06713c9760e077f635dee62 OP_EQUAL
address
3HsBhX4HMr3fD7wfumcDX48SiNpnfLUq2V
transaction
35c20b84b85e09771a76160c081d3e9b9f184680157e4137de5cc03db1b715e7
spent
true